Application Deadline for the Prevention and Recovery Support Services Fund Extended to November 4
Newsroom | Office of the Lieutenant Governor | Date Posted: Tuesday, October 25, 2022
DOVER, DE – In September, Lieutenant Governor Bethany Hall-Long, PhD, RN, announced the creation of the Prevention and Recovery Support Services Fund to reduce overdose deaths across Delaware by addressing barriers to sustained recovery such as transportation, housing and workforce capacity. The deadline for applications has been extended. Organizations, including service providers and community organizations, may submit funding […]
